The XSOAR administrator is writing an automation and would like to return an error entry back into XSOAR if a particular command errors out. How can this be achieved?

  • A. Using the demisto_error() function
  • B. Using a print statement
  • C. Using the demisto.debug() function
  • D. Using the return_error() function
